Le Dauphin Montréal Centre-Ville
Concrete Cool, Family Roots
A Family Affair, Downtown Edition
Owned and operated by the same family for three generations, Le Dauphin brings no-frills hospitality with a local touch. This Montréal outpost—one of five across Québec—is just steps from the Convention Center (Palais des congrès) and caters smartly to business travelers and city explorers alike.
Industrial, But Inviting
The design is clean and contemporary, with exposed concrete walls, wooden floors, and a palette that favors natural tones over trend-chasing gimmicks. Guest rooms are unexpectedly spacious, and each comes with a full Apple iMac, doubling as entertainment center and workhorse in one.
Practical Perks
Rates include breakfast, a rarity in this part of town, and the service is fuss-free but genuinely warm. There’s no bar or restaurant on-site, but with Chinatown, Old Montreal, and the downtown core just a few blocks away, you’re well placed to explore.
